Professor Ben Eggleton

The University of Sydney

Benjamin Eggleton is the Pro Vice-Chancellor (Research) at the University of Sydney, where he oversees the university’s research operations division. Eggleton is also a Professor in the School of Physics, where he leads a cutting-edge experimental photonics group focused on nonlinear optics, photonic integrated circuits, and smart sensors. Eggleton is Co-Director of the NSW Smart Sensing Network (NSSN), heads the Jericho Smart Sensing Laboratory (JSSL), sponsored by the Royal Australian Air Force and is a Chief Investigator at the ARC Centre of Excellence in Optical Microcombs for Breakthrough Science (COMBS). Eggleton has published over 520 journal articles has accumulated over 30,000 citations, with an h-index of 89 (Web of Science). He is a Fellow of Optica, IEEE Photonics, SPIE, the Australian Academy of Technological Sciences and Engineering (ATSE), and the Australian Academy of Science (AAS). Eggleton served as President of the Australian Optical Society (2008–2010), on the IEEE Photonics Board of Governors (2015–2017) and is Editor-in-Chief of APL Photonics since 2015.
